Amy Benjamin is a national education consultant and author of twelve books on teaching literacy, including Infusing Grammar Into the Writer’s Workshop with Barbara Golub. Before becoming a consultant, she was an award-winning English teacher in Montrose, New York.
"As educators move beyond their first year or so in the workshop model, they are often looking for ways to expand upon what they have been doing. This book will allow them to incorporate vocabulary instruction into the language arts instruction model they have been using. Good teachers know that vocabulary instruction is not very successful in the worksheet model that has been around for the last few decades. It is nice to see a text that moves away from it and incorporates it into a reading/writing model that many are using. It is obvious that the author has spent significant time in a classroom." – Erin Keane, Taipei American School
